On his latest single, “Badlands,” Missouri-raised singer-songwriter Kevin Morby sings: “Kansas City is not the badlands, but it’s my badlands.”

It’s the third preview of his upcoming release, Little Wide Open, and Morby gives a lot of love to his homeland as he sings: “Welcome to the Midwest // Where the sky knows best // And you’ll finally get some rest // ’Til the tornado sirens start harmonizing // And I can’t tell if I’m in heaven or if I’m in the badlands.”

To emphasize the seasonal/topical tornadic appeal, Amelia Meath of Sylvan Esso and Justin Vernon of Bon Iver harmonize with Morby to create a vocalization of tornado sirens. Hopefully, those are the only ones we’ll hear for a while, and they’ll be part of Little Wide Open when it comes out May 15 (with Morby dropping by the Argo a few weeks later, June 1).
